regarding excemption on rent

Date 10 Feb 2024
Replies 11 Replies
Views 1141 Views
GST exemption on staff residential rent and whether input tax credit must be proportionately reversed under reversal rules.
Whether rent charged by a Government of India undertaking from employees for residential quarters is an exempt supply under GST and whether common input tax credit must be proportionately reversed. The unit declared such receipts as exempt in GSTR-3B; a show cause notice requires reversal or deposit of tax. The department has sought reversal under the input tax credit reversal rules. The enquiry also raises the issue of different treatment if residential facilities were provided to outsiders rather than employees. (AI Summary)

a government of india undertaking unit of factory engaged in the business of manufacturing at rae bareli collected rent of Rs-1,17,20,657/- from there employee on the residential facility provided to staff in the quatres(House) build for residential purpose and declared it in GSTR-3B as exempt supply. factory received SCN u/s 73 requiring to deposit tax on exempt supply. kindly advise it is exempt supply or taxable on the basis of RCM.

If it is rent collected for the residential accommodation provided to the employees then there is an exemption available. GST is not liable

Like 0
Replied on Feb 12, 2024
6.

However, you should check whether the department is asking you to pay GST on the rentals or it is asking you to reverse proportionate input tax credit?

Like 0
Replied on Feb 12, 2024
7.

In case it is for reversal of credit, most probably the department would have taken the entire credit availed by the company and calculated the reversal.

You should consider only the common credit for the reversal and any specific credit.

If further clarity can be provided guidance can be given.
